Betting Odds and Strategies for the Raiders vs. Seahawks Matchup
Betting odds and strategies for the Raiders vs. Seahawks matchup are of great interest to those looking to wager on the game. Understanding the various betting options is essential, including the money line (picking the winner), point spread (predicting the margin of victory), and over/under (total points scored). Monitoring the odds from different sportsbooks is important, as they can vary, providing potential opportunities for value. Analyzing the trends and statistics related to each team's performance can help identify betting opportunities. For example, a team with a strong running game might be a good bet against a defense that struggles to stop the run. Considering the impact of home-field advantage, the weather conditions, and any significant injuries is also crucial for making informed betting decisions. Strategies may involve focusing on specific player props, such as the number of passing yards or touchdowns, or betting on the first half or the game's total score. Diversifying bets and managing the bankroll are important, as no bet is a guaranteed win. It is crucial to approach betting responsibly, setting limits and avoiding chasing losses. Anticipating Potential Game-Changing Moments
Anticipating potential game-changing moments is crucial for understanding the Raiders vs. Seahawks matchup. Game-changing moments can be any event that drastically shifts the game's momentum or outcome. Turnovers, such as interceptions and fumbles, are classic game-changers, instantly affecting field position and scoring opportunities. Special teams plays, including long returns, blocked punts, and missed field goals, can also swing the game's momentum. Unexpected injuries to key players can create significant challenges for a team and provide opportunities for the opponent. Weather conditions, such as heavy rain or strong winds, can affect the game's flow, forcing teams to adapt their strategies. Crucial penalties, particularly those that extend drives or nullify scoring plays, can also alter the game's trajectory. Coaches' decisions, such as going for it on fourth down or opting for a two-point conversion, can also be pivotal.
